The Basics of Car Export Costs
When you consider exporting a car from the UAE, the primary costs you should prepare for include:
- Shipping Fees: The cost to physically transport the vehicle to its destination.
- Customs Duties: Fees imposed by the destination country for bringing in a vehicle.
- Insurance: Protecting your investment during transit is crucial.
- Documentation Fees: Costs associated with preparing the necessary export documents.
Hidden Fees to Watch Out For
Beyond the basic costs, there are often hidden fees that can significantly increase the total cost of exporting a car. These include:
- Inspection Fees: Some countries require a vehicle inspection before allowing it to enter.
- Storage Fees: If your vehicle is held at the port for an extended period, storage fees may apply.
- Handling Fees: Charges for loading and unloading the vehicle at the shipping port.
- Broker Fees: If you hire a broker to manage the export process, their fees can add up.
